What are some common challenges faced by internal auditors when conducting audits across different departments?

Internal auditors often face challenges such as navigating varying processes and controls among departments, dealing with resistance or reluctance from staff, and balancing objectivity while building trust. Each department may have unique operations, requiring auditors to quickly adapt their approach and communication style. Effective collaboration, clear communication, and continuous learning about evolving regulations and best practices are essential to overcome these challenges and ensure thorough, unbiased audits.

What are internal auditors?

Internal auditors are professionals within an organization who evaluate and improve the effectiveness of risk management, control, and governance processes. They conduct independent assessments of financial and operational systems to ensure compliance with laws, regulations, and company policies. Their work helps organizations identify inefficiencies, prevent fraud, and ensure accurate financial reporting. Internal auditors also provide recommendations to management for improving processes and mitigating risks.

What is the difference between Internal Auditing vs External Auditing?

AspectInternal AuditingExternal Auditing
CertificationsCIA, CPA, CISACPA, CIA
Work EnvironmentWithin the organization, ongoingIndependent, outside the organization, periodic
EmployerCompany or organizationPublic accounting firms, external agencies
FocusInternal controls, risk management, operational efficiencyFinancial statement accuracy, compliance with standards

Internal Auditing involves evaluating an organization's internal controls and processes from within, often focusing on operational improvements. External Auditing is conducted by independent firms to verify financial statements' accuracy and compliance. Both roles require similar certifications like CPA and CIA, but differ in their work environment and primary focus.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Internal Auditor,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internal Auditor, you need a solid understanding of accounting principles, risk assessment, and internal controls, typically supported by a degree in accounting or finance and often a CIA (Certified Internal Auditor) certification. Familiarity with audit management software, data analytics tools,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ems is commonly required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help Internal Auditors identify issues and clearly present findings to stakeholders. These abilities are crucial for ensuring organizational compliance, minimizing risks, and improving operational efficiency.

Summary

The Internal Auditor is responsible for providing an independent, objective assurance and consulting function that adds value and improves Lee Healths operations. This role is pivotal in ensuring the accuracy and integrity of the financial and operational practices within the not-for-profit healthcare organization. The Internal Auditor will evaluate the effectiveness of risk management, control, and governance processes to safeguard assets, verify the reliability of financial reporting, ensure compliance with laws and regulations, and improve organizational efficiency.

Requirements

Education:Bachelors degree in accounting, Finance, or a related field required. Master's preferred.

Experience:Minimum of 3 years of experience in internal auditing or equivalent operational experience , with a strong preference for experience in the healthcare or not- for-profit sector.

Certification:Certified Internal Auditor (CIA), Certified Public Accountant (CPA), or Certified Healthcare Internal Audit Professional (CHIAP) preferred.

License:N/A

Other:In-depth knowledge of auditing standards, healthcare regulations, and financial management principles in a not-for- profit environment.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ills. High ethical standards, integrity, and confidentiality.
